Built for Extremely Busy Driving Ranges and High-Volume Golf Courses

RangeForce is engineered for commercial facilities that demand the most durable golf range mats and high-performance driving range mats available today.

When your driving range operates at full capacity day after day, standard mats eventually break down under pressure. Concentrated impact zones, high swing speeds, and constant rotation accelerate fiber fatigue and shorten usable life.

The RangeForce High-Traffic Driving Range Matsβ„’ are engineered for facilities that demand more β€” more durability, more structural integrity, and more seasons of performance.

This is the upgrade designed specifically for extreme traffic environments where longevity matters.

Facilities located in coastal regions, high-humidity climates, or high-heat zones face additional stress beyond traffic alone. Salt-laden air, persistent moisture, and temperature swings accelerate fiber fatigue in standard commercial mats.

RangeForceβ„’ was developed to address these combined traffic and climate pressures.

Very busy ranges create wear patterns that typical commercial mats cannot withstand long-term. Repeated ball striking in the same hitting areas causes fiber collapse, thinning, and inconsistent turf response. RangeForce™ features a high-grade, ultra-dense nylon hitting surface designed to:

  • Withstand continuous daily play
  • Maintain fiber resilience under high swing speeds
  • Reduce concentrated wear zones
  • Preserve consistent ball-strike feedback
In coastal and humid regions, microscopic salt particles and moisture gradually penetrate traditional nylon fibers. Over time, this weakens structural integrity and leads to premature thinning.

RangeForce™ upgrades the hitting surface to a salt and humidity-resistant nylon system engineered for long-term structural stability.

Built for Harsh Outdoor Environments


Heat, humidity, and coastal air accelerate fiber degradation in standard turf systems. Moisture exposure and environmental stress can weaken traditional nylon over time. RangeForce™ utilizes a climate-stabilized nylon construction engineered to perform in:
  • High humidity regions
  • Coastal environments
  • Outdoor uncovered tee lines
  • High-heat summer conditions
This advanced turf system helps extend usable life in demanding climates.

Unlike standard commercial turf systems originally designed for moderate climates, RangeForce™ is engineered specifically for regions where humidity, heat, and ocean air are persistent operating conditions β€” not occasional variables.

Extended Multi-Season Performance

For high-traffic ranges, the difference directly impacts long-term operational cost

Standard commercial driving range mats typically average 2–3 years of service life, depending on traffic and environment. RangeForce™ is designed for facilities exceeding normal usage levels and seeking to extend replacement cycles.

For high-volume practice, these driving range golf mats solve common issues that facilities operating in coastal, high-heat, and high-humidity environments face.

  • Accelerated mat degradation due to salt vapor, moisture saturation, and prolonged UV exposure.
  • Salt in the air can break down standard golf mat fibers over time, while constant humidity weakens backing materials and promotes premature wear.
Upgrading to a salt- and moisture-resistant nylon system that is specifically engineered to withstand these harsh conditions allows facilities to extend mat lifespan by several years beyond traditional commercial-grade options.

FAQs - Ask the Driving Range Golf Mat Experts™

Choose mats with dense nylon turf, reinforced backing, UV resistance, heat-sealed edges, and 1ΒΌβ€³ thickness.
These features ensure durability, realistic ball response, and long-lasting performance. Facility owners should also consider rotational flexibility to extend mat life.

Consider daily swing volume, indoor/outdoor use, climate exposure, and whether hitting stations allow rotation. High-traffic public ranges need heavier-duty mats, while private teaching bays or seasonal facilities can use lighter options.

For high-volume ranges, rotating mats every 1–2 weeks prevents concentrated impact wear. Octagon designs provide multiple rotation points to extend lifespan.

High-quality mats provide consistent strike response, helping golfers receive accurate feedback. Lower-quality mats can mask mishits and create unrealistic feedback.

Yes. Thin or overly rigid mats increase stress on wrists, elbows, and shoulders during repeated swings. Properly constructed driving range mats absorb shock while maintaining stability.

The most popular sizes are 5x5 square or 5x5 octagon. The square mat can rotate at 4 rotation points, and the octagon in 8, distributing wear evenly and extending lifespan.
